    Changed MB and CPU; Can't reactivate


    I change my MB and CPU and now can't reactivate my Windows 10 Pro.

    The troubleshooter tells me:

    "It looks like the hardware on this device has changed. Make sure you're connected to the Internet and try again later. 0xc0ea000a"


    I AM connected to the internet obviously, since I'm posting here


    Using the "I changed the hardware" option doesn't list the device I upgraded. However, the desktop is still listed under devices in my Microsoft Account.


    In desperation, I even tried to buy a new license which I shouldn't have to do, but it would only let me upgrade to the Enterprise edition


    I entered the product key under change the product key and got the Unable To Activate error.


    It will not let me connect to MS customer support.


    I'm at wit's end.

    Hi John. I'm Greg, an installation specialist and 8 year Windows MVP, here to help you.

    If Windows came pre-installed on the PC then changing the motherboard voids the license. Free Upgrade inherits that restriction. You'll need to buy a new license:

    http://www.microsoftstore.com/store/msusa/en_US...


    If it was retail Windows then follow these steps for reactivating:
    https://support.microsoft.com/en-us/help/20530/...
